Output e5fc38acb68b182365e78ca4d9a74a081fe7cf1c8be57cbb6ef9e75269b02da0:0

value
705902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c881c6ebdaa93a83d5dfa72f9fd66b3ee2cbf58f OP_EQUAL
address
3KyCXyasc9PayJoS96gf4zsea5KruBo2Ss
transaction
e5fc38acb68b182365e78ca4d9a74a081fe7cf1c8be57cbb6ef9e75269b02da0
spent
true